在构建网页时,HTML5引入了一系列语义化标签,这些标签不仅让网页的结构更加清晰,而且有助于提升搜索引擎优化(SEO)效果。下面,我们将详细解析HTML5语义化标签的使用技巧与案例。
1. 语义化标签的重要性
1.1 提升网页可读性
语义化标签能够明确地告诉浏览器和用户网页的结构,使得网页内容更加易于理解和阅读。
1.2 提高SEO效果
搜索引擎爬虫在抓取网页内容时,会优先考虑语义化标签。使用这些标签有助于搜索引擎更好地理解网页内容,从而提高网页的排名。
2. 常用HTML5语义化标签
2.1 文档结构标签
<header>:表示网页或页面区域的页眉部分。<nav>:表示导航链接的部分。<main>:表示网页的主要内容。<footer>:表示网页或页面区域的页脚部分。
2.2 内容区域标签
<article>:表示页面中的独立内容,如博客文章、新闻条目等。<section>:表示页面中的一个内容区块,通常包含一个标题。<aside>:表示页面内容的一部分,通常与主内容相关,但可以独立存在。
2.3 表单标签
<form>:表示表单元素。<label>:表示表单控件的标签。<input>:表示输入字段。<button>:表示按钮。
2.4 媒体标签
<audio>:表示音频内容。<video>:表示视频内容。
3. 使用技巧
3.1 合理使用语义化标签
在编写HTML5代码时,应根据实际需求合理使用语义化标签。避免滥用标签,导致网页结构混乱。
3.2 遵循结构化原则
在构建网页时,应遵循从上到下、从左到右的结构化原则,使网页结构清晰易懂。
3.3 优化标签嵌套
合理嵌套语义化标签,使网页结构更加合理。
4. 案例分析
4.1 案例一:使用<header>和<footer>标签
<header>
<h1>网站标题</h1>
<nav>
<ul>
<li><a href="#">首页</a></li>
<li><a href="#">关于我们</a></li>
<li><a href="#">联系方式</a></li>
</ul>
</nav>
</header>
<main>
<!-- 网页主要内容 -->
</main>
<footer>
<p>版权所有 © 2021 网站名称</p>
</footer>
4.2 案例二:使用<article>和<section>标签
<article>
<header>
<h2>文章标题</h2>
</header>
<section>
<h3>文章内容一</h3>
<p>这里是文章内容一。</p>
</section>
<section>
<h3>文章内容二</h3>
<p>这里是文章内容二。</p>
</section>
</article>
通过以上案例,我们可以看到,合理使用HTML5语义化标签可以使网页结构更加清晰,提升用户体验和SEO效果。
5. 总结
HTML5语义化标签在提升网页可读性和SEO效果方面具有重要意义。掌握这些标签的使用技巧,有助于我们构建更加优秀的网页。
